At the national level, the Lao PDR remains firmly committed to the implementation of the SDGs through its National Socio-Economic Development Plan and Vision 2030, all of which prioritize inclusive social development and poverty eradication. Efforts to graduate from LDC status are ongoing, supported by strategies focusing on green growth, human resource development, regulatory reform, and social protection for vulnerable populations. The preparation of the 10th NSEDP (2026–2030) will continue to emphasize poverty reduction and leaving no one behind.
5. Despite progress, challenges remain, including economic vulnerabilities, natural disasters, rural-urban disparities, poverty eradication, disaster preparedness, technology transfer, and digital connectivity.
